Arduino IDE: Što je razvojno i programsko okruženje za Arduino i koje dijelove ima?

Zadnje ažuriranje: 14/09/2022
Arduino-IDE.-Što-je-Arduino-razvojno-i-programsko-okruženje-i-koje-dijelove-ima

El IDE je programsko okruženje koje se koristi za razvoj projekata u bilo kojem ploča arduinoStoga, da biste ostvarili svoje ideje, morat ćete savršeno znati što je ovaj softver.

Zbog toga, Pripremili smo sljedeći članakTo će vam omogućiti da lako naučite sve dijelove sučelja IDE. Pronaći ćete ilustrativne slike koje će vam pomoći da učvrstite koncepte. 

Ali to nije sve, reći ćemo vam i verzije koje je IDE imao i korake koje trebate poduzeti za njegovu instalaciju Ovo okruženje na vašem računalu.

Što je Arduino IDE ili razvojno okruženje i za što se koristi ta platforma?

Interaktivno razvojno okruženje ili IDEProgramer, ili akronim na engleskom, je programer koji se koristi za kompajliranje i interpretaciju koda za razvoj programa. koji se koriste na Arduino ploči. Kompatibilan je s Linux i Windows, pa je njihova svestranost još jedna prednost ovih uređaja za elektroničke projekte.

Jezici koje podržava uključuju, između ostalog:

  • Zasjeniti.
  • Emacs Lisp.
  • GNU Emacs.
  • IntelliJ IDEJA.
  • MonoDevelop.
  • MojaPomrčina.
  • NetBeans.
  • Biser.
  • PHP.
  • Python.
  • Rubin.

Upoznavanje Arduino IDE-a: Koji su svi dijelovi njegovog sučelja?

Grafičko sučelje IDE-a sastoji se od sljedećih dijelova:

Glavni zaslon

Glavni zaslon

Glavni ekran ima 5 karticaOni predstavljaju skupinu različitih alata. Također ima alatnu traku za brzi pristup funkcijama. Potvrdi, Prenesi, Novo, Otvori y Spremiti. Prvo što ćete vidjeti je skica s zadanim nazivom datuma.

Zatim ćete pronaći naredbe s kojima je program spreman za rad:

void setup() { // ovdje stavite svoj kod za postavljanje, za jednokratno izvođenje: } void loop() { // ovdje stavite svoj glavni kod, za višekratno izvođenje: }

Na kraju ekrana Naći ćete područje namijenjeno primanju poruka iz programa, nazvano IDE konzola za poruke.

Glavni izbornik

Glavnom izborniku možete pristupiti s početnog zaslona, ​​gdje ćete pronaći ove alate:

  • Izbornik Datoteka: U ovom odjeljku pronaći ćete funkcije koje će vam pomoći u stvaranju nove skice, otvaranju nedavne, pronalaženju projekta, pretraživanju korisnih primjera, zatvaranju skice, spremanju skice, spremanju novog projekta, konfiguriranju stranice za ispis i resetiranju radnih postavki. To vam omogućuje upravljanje različitim projektima i konfiguriranje njihovog okruženja.

Glavni izbornik

  • Izbornik za uređivanje: kada kliknete na karticu Uredi Pronaći ćete funkcije koje će vam omogućiti poništavanje ili ponavljanje posljednje radnje, izrezivanje, kopiranje, kopiranje na forum, kopiranje kodova kao HTML-a, lijepljenje kodova, odabir cijelog sadržaja, odlazak na određeni redak, komentiranje i poništavanje komentara u retku, povećanje ili smanjenje uvlake, povećanje ili smanjenje veličine fonta i izvođenje određenih pretraga.

Glavni izbornik

  • Izbornik programa: ako trebate mijenjati operacije ili funkcije projekta Ovaj izbornik trebate koristiti za pristup kodu koji ste učitali u svoju skicu. Ovdje ćete pronaći funkcije koje će vam pomoći u provjeri i kompajliranju koda, prijenosu koda, prijenosu pomoću programatora, izvozu pomoću binarnih brojeva, prikazu mape programa, uključivanju određene biblioteke i dodavanju datoteke.

Glavni izbornik

  • Izbornik Alati: U ovom odjeljku možete koristiti funkcije koje će vam pomoći u konfiguriranju alata koji Oni su izvan Arduino programskog okruženja.Zato ćete pronaći funkciju automatskog formatiranja, programsku datoteku, popravak koda, upravljanje bibliotekama, serijski monitor, serijski port plotera, promjenu tipa ploče, promjenu priključka za povezivanje ploče, dobivanje informacija o ploči koja se koristi u razvoju, promjenu tipa programatora i snimanje bootloadera.

Glavni izbornik

  • Izbornik pomoći: Kao što i samo ime govori, u ovom odjeljku možete pronaći pomoć za izvršiti brzi početak, rješavajte probleme, pronađite često postavljana pitanja i saznajte informacije o Arduinu.

Traka za brzi pristup

Traka za brzi pristup

Alatna traka za brzi pristup sadrži sljedeće funkcije:

  • Ček: Ovaj alat se koristi za pronalaženje mape programa i njezine lokacije. Također će vam pomoći provjeriti je li kod ispravno napisan. Da biste to učinili, morate odabrati skupinu kodova, a zatim kliknuti na ovu radnju.
  • Povećati: Ovu funkciju moći ćete koristiti nakon što pripremite kod za most i trebate ga prenijeti na Arduino ploču.
  • Novi: Možete započeti novi projekt na kojem ćete raditi.
  • Otvoren: Ovaj alat će vam omogućiti otvaranje projekta na kojem ste već radili i spremili ga na računalo.
  • Spremiti: Ovaj alat se koristi kada želite spremiti projekt na određenu putanju.
  • Serijski monitor: Smješten na desnoj strani trake za brzi pristup, ovaj alat se koristi za otvaranje konzole za poruke.

Traka s porukama

Traka s porukama

Ovo je posljednji dio grafičkog sučelja IDE-a, u kojem Naći ćete konzolu koja će vas obavještavati o porukama. kada postoje greške u izvornom kodu projekta.

Koje sve verzije Arduino razvojnog okruženja postoje?

Trenutna verzija IDE-a koju možete preuzeti na svoje računalo je 18.13koji je (kao što smo već spomenuli) kompatibilan sa sustavima Windows 7, 8.1 i 10; macOS od verzije 10.10 nadalje; i Linux, u 32-bitnoj i 64-bitnoj verziji, te na 32-bitnim i 64-bitnim ARM sustavima. Ali ovo nije jedina verzija Arduino programsko okruženje.

U nastavku ćete pronaći potpuni popis svih verzija prije verzije 1.8.13, počevši od najstarije:

  • Arduino 0001. Objavljeno 25. kolovoza 2005. Bila je to prva alfa verzija u kojoj je uveden knjižnični jezik.
  • Arduino 0002. Dva mjeseca kasnije lansirana je druga verzija, u kojoj je uveden proces konstrukcije koji je omogućio dodavanje poznatijeg izbornika.
  • Arduino 0003. Kao i prethodna verzija, ovo izdanje dolazi dva mjeseca nakon svog prethodnika. Uključuje ispravke programskih pogrešaka, ažurirani API i nove značajke specifične za [novu verziju]. jezik C i dodana je funkcija Serijskog monitora.
  • Arduino 0004. Javnosti je objavljen 26. travnja 2006., uspostavljajući C++ jezik za skice. Dodane su biblioteke Matrix i Sprite.
  • Arduino 0005. Nakon 5 mjeseci, čini se da ova verzija poboljšava Linux okruženje pri korištenju pretraživanja alata AVR.
  • Arduino 0006. U listopadu 2006. ova je verzija objavljena za MacOS sustav, koji više nije zahtijevao Javu 1.5. Dodana je i podrška za analogne ulaze.
  • Arduino 0007. Krajem 2006. godine objavljena je nova jezgra, mnogo manja od prethodnika, sada teška samo 3,5 KB. Implementirana je rutina Serial.flush() koja omogućuje upite referenci.
  • Arduino 0008. U lipnju 2007. dodane su biblioteke za koračne motore i EEPROM memorije. Osim toga, mikrokontroler je nadograđen s ATmega168 na ATmega8.
  • Arduino 0009. Ova verzija je objavljena 6. kolovoza 2007. kako bi dodala podršku za Arduino Diecimila ploču.
  • Arduino 0010. Krajem 2007. godine objavljena je i podrška za matične ploče LilyPad i Vista. Osim toga, napravljena je distribucija za MacOS X, a poboljšane su i poruke o pogreškama sustava.
  • Arduino 0011. Funkcije map(), analogReference(), interrupts() i noInterrupts() pojavljuju se u ovoj verziji. Dodan je i parametar timeout procesa.
  • Arduino 0012. U rujnu 2008., Pro i Pro Mini ploče su dodane u izbornik. Uključeno je nekoliko biblioteka, a Millis() je poboljšan.
  • Arduino 0013. Ova verzija, objavljena 6. veljače 2009., poboljšava brzinu učitavanja mikrokontrolera ATmega328. Također dodaje funkcije kao što su word(), bitWrite() i highByte(), između ostalog.
  • Arduino 0014. Greške koje su sprječavale povezivanje su ispravljene i AVR za MacOS je ažuriran.
  • Arduino 0015. Ova verzija uključuje Arduino Mega ploču.
  • Arduino 0016. Sada je dostupna podrška za Arduino Pro, Pro Mini i LilyPad ploče. Osim toga, optimiziran je kontroler za timer0.
  • Arduino 0017. Biblioteka LiquidCrystal dobila je ažuriranje 25. srpnja 2009. Nadalje, moguće je raditi s do 12 servo motora na gotovo svim pločama.

Naučite korak po korak kako instalirati najnoviju verziju Arduino IDE-a na svoje računalo

Za instalaciju na najnoviju verziju Arduino IDE-a, morate slijediti ove korake prikazane u nastavku:

Posjetite službenu Arduino web stranicu

Prvo što trebate učiniti je pristupiti Arduino web stranici pomoću preglednika. https://www.arduino.cc/en/Main/Software i idite na karticu SOFTVERTada ćete morati pronaći Preuzmite Arduino IDE i kliknite na softver koji ste instalirali na svoje računalo.

Preuzmite IDE programator

Kada kliknete na željeni operativni sustav, otvorit će se novi prozor s pitanjem želite li financijski doprinijeti podršci Arduinu. Da biste to učinili, morate kliknuti na... DOPRINOSI I PREUZMIU suprotnom, morat ćete kliknuti na SAMO PREUZIMANJE.

Izvršite instalaciju

U ovom trenutku morat ćete nastaviti s koracima koje je naznačio čarobnjak za instalaciju, odabrati putanju preuzimanja i zatim kliknuti na Uštedite. Nakon nekoliko minuta morat ćete raspakirati datoteku arduino-1.8.13-[naziv vašeg operativnog sustava].zip.

Ne zaboravite konfigurirati port i verziju ploče

Za početak rada bez grešaka Morat ćete konfigurirati IDE da mu kažete na koji port ste spojili ploču. Arduino A koji je ovo model? Za to će vam trebati pristup alat i odaberite funkcije ploča y Luka kako biste prilagodili svoje opcije.

E-knjige od IPAP
Ebooks IPAP

🔥PRIDRUŽITE SE🔥 NOVOJ IP@P ZAJEDNICI! PRIJAVITE SE OVDJE!

Teme

Autor: Félix Albornoz

Imam preko 20 godina iskustva rada u tehnološkom sektoru, pomažući tvrtkama i korisnicima da se razvijaju i obučavaju u ovom području. Uvijek učim nove stvari.

Povezano